The Toscana Classica festival, which promotes and supports the professional activity of young musicians, singers, and musical ensembles, will begin on Saturday, March 14th.

The opening concerts will take place at the Church of Santa Felicita in Florence: the Orchestra Toscana Classica, conducted by Giovan Battista Varoli, will perform together with soloists Matteo Michelini and Diego Aleman on bassoons.

A very young violin talent, Leone Pini, will appear as soloist with the Orchestra Toscana Classica on Thursday, April 2nd at the Sala Capitolare San Giorgio alla Costa. On April 22nd, again in the same hall, the organist Antonio Frigé will join the Orchestra Toscana Classica, conducted by Giuseppe Lanzetta.
